How Our Wet Vacuum Water Extraction Process Works in Richmond Park, NV

Our Wet Vacuum Water Extraction process is built around speed, efficiency, and effectiveness. We understand that every minute counts with water damage, and our team is equipped to respond quickly and effectively. Our process is designed to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as soon as possible. Here’s an overview of what you can expect:

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will arrive at your home and assess the extent of the water damage. We’ll identify the source of the leak, take photos and notes, and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ry your property. We’ll work with you to find out the best course of action and answer any questions you may have.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and ensure that all affected areas are properly addressed.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Next, our team will use our Wet Vacuum Water Extraction equipment to extract the water from your home. This involves using powerful pumps and vacuums to remove water from the affected areas, including carpets, upholstery, and hard floors. We’ll remove as much water as possible to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th. Our team will work methodically to ensure that every inch of affected space is thoroughly cleaned and dried.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ized drying equipment to remove any remaining moisture from your home. This includes the use of powerful dehumidifiers and air movers to speed up the drying process and prevent further damage. We’ll work to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as quickly as possible.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Deodorizing

Finally, our team will sanitize and deodorize your home to remove any remaining bacteria, viruses, or other contaminants that may have been introduced during the water damage. We’ll leave your home smelling fresh and clean and give you peace of mind knowing that your property is safe and healthy.

Warning Signs You Need Wet Vacuum Water Extraction in Richmond Park, NV

Ignoring the sign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Don’t wait until it’s too late. If you notice any of the following warning signs, it’s time to call our team: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Are you noticing a persistent musty smell in your home, even after cleaning and airing it out? This could be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th. Don’t ignore this warning. Our team can help you identify the source of the odor and provide prompt and effective Wet Vacuum Water Extraction services.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Are you noticing water stains or discoloration on your walls, ceilings, or floors? This could be a sign of water damage that’s spreading. Don’t delay. Our team can help you contain the damage and prevent further spread.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Are your floors warped or buckled due to water damage? This can be a sign of significant water damage that needs immediate attention. Don’t wait. Our team can help you repair or replace your flooring and restore your home to its original condition.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Are you noticing peeling paint or wallpaper due to water damage? This can be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th. Don’t ignore this warning.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ide prompt and effective Wet Vacuum Water Extraction services.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Are you noticing unusual sounds or leaks in your home? This could be a sign of a hidden water leak or drainage issue. Don’t delay.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ide prompt and effective Wet Vacuum Water Extraction services.

Wet Vacuum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om Yes No DIY fixes are usually effective for small, contained leaks. But, if you’re unsure about the extent of the damage or the source of the leak, it’s best to err on the side of caution and call a professional.
Widespread water damage after a flood No Yes Widespread water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ract water and dry the affected areas. DIY fixes can lead to further damage and health risks.
Hidden water damage behind walls or ceilings No Yes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ect and needs specialized equipment to identify and fix. DIY fixes can lead to further damage and health risks.

While DIY fixes can be effective for small, contained leaks, water damage is a serious issue that needs professional attention. If you’re unsure about the extent of the damage or the source of the leak, it’s always best to err on the side of caution and call a professional. Wet Vacuum Water Extraction Cost in Richmond Park, NV

The cost of Wet Vacuum Water Extraction services can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Richmond Park, NV. Est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ide a personalized estimate after inspecting your property and assessing the extent of the damage. We’ll work with you to find out the best course of action and answer any questions you may have.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ial assessment and planning $200 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ed
Water extraction $500 – $2,000 Volume of water, equipment needed, labor required
Drying and dehumidification $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, equipment needed, labor required
